NaCu3F7 is a copper-sodium fluoride compound that belongs to the family of metal fluorides, which are ionic materials combining metallic and halide elements. This material is primarily of research interest rather than established in mainstream industrial production, and represents exploration within fluoride metallurgy for potential electronic, optical, or electrochemical applications where fluoride compounds offer unique properties such as high electronegativity and ionic conductivity.
